This project focuses on developing dual-specific proteins to target multiple cancer-related receptors, enhancing therapeutic options for patients. By engineering small peptides and natural ligands, it aims to create innovative treatments for cancer, including molecular imaging and targeted drug delivery.
The dysregulation of signaling pathways that mediate cell proliferation, survival and migration is an underlying cause of many cancers.
In particular, dysregulation and over-expression of avb3 integrin, membrane-type-1 matrix metalloproteinase (MT1-MMP; also known as matrix metalloproteinase-14, MMP14) and vascular endothelial growth factor receptor-2 (VEGFR2) correlate with poor prognosis in many human tumors, making these proteins attractive targets for therapeutic intervention.
